Compared several bags - chose this one - glad we did

This carrier has a lot to like. We read reviews before purchasing and only bought (2) 5 star bags to compare and ultimately choose between. We kept that. We have a stocky cat weighing 15 pounds. We wanted a backpack so my daughter could easily move around the airport with carry-on luggage and a cat when flying alone. There was plenty of room for him. It had enough room to lie comfortably when the bag was upright. Although there was less "floor space" than a typical padded shoulder carrier when the bag was upright, it was a smoother ride for him as he was riding on her back rather than alongside her and a large round (and low) net pushing gave him plenty of vision and air while lying down. When I sat there was a surprising amount of room in the bag. It also has a zipped mesh area so when seated it still has plenty of view, air and exceptional space. It has an additional "pop-up" room, fully meshed. The designers of this bag really focused on the cat's comfort, so the mesh windows (which allowed for great breathability and visual access) didn't have pockets, but my daughter actually used the "pull out" zippered section as a pocket and was able to grab her treats , their medication, rubber gloves, extra dropper pad and hand wipes. We examined the seams. Time will tell if it will hold up, but it seems well made. The padded shoulder straps are very comfortable. The final deciding factor was that this pack had both a sternum strap and a lower waist/waist strap. Our daughter said she distributed the weight well on her body so she didn't have to lean forward and also helped support the bag so our burly cat didn't sag and the bag didn't collapse. He was on an airplane, lying well under the seat (which, when placed on its back, gives as much room as any other shoulder bag for his in-flight comfort. He was so comfortable in his holdall that he sat up and bathed at the airport.Anyone who has a cat knows that this will not happen if the cat is not comfortable and safe (see attached picture).
